The X Factor: Top 7

by Todd Betzold

 

We saw two acts go home last week and another two will go home this week, as the singers on The X Factor take on the King of Pop, Michael Jackson.

 

Two acts will be sent home again, with the act having the lowest vote being automatically sent home and the next two lowest vote-getters battling it out for the judges' votes to see who will survive.

 

Not only is it Michael Jackson week, but they bring out the big guns and have some of the Jacksons in attendance: his brothers Marlon, Jackie and Tito; his mother, Katherine and his children, Prince, Paris and Blanket.

 

Up first tonight is Josh Krajcik, trying to be the last over 30s to survive is nervous this week because it is going out of his comfort zone...I'm not worried, he's amazing. I enjoyed it, but it was not as good as his previous performances. There were a lot of things going on around him that took away from his singing, but I'll think he'll be back next week.

 

Astro hits the stage next, as he takes on the King with his rap-style. He enjoyed himself on the stage and he does great writing his own lyrics, but again I wasn't feeling this performance...just seemed lackluster to me. I love the kid, but seemed dull to me.

 

Simon said he is removing all the props and gimmicks for Drew's performance this week...how will that work out? She took "Billie Jean" and twisted it all around and I enjoyed that. It was a boring performance again from her, but the vocals were amazing...and another arguing match between the judges over Drew. This time between Nicole and Paula vs. Simon...I agree with the ladies...sorry Simon!

 

Time for my girl, Rachel Crow, to work the stage. She did well and worked that stage. I did not like the song choice for her, but she could sing the phone book to me and I would love it. I feel she has the X Factor, so vote for her!

 

Now this might be the performance of the night, in my eyes, as Marcus Canty takes the stage. Besides the big production on the stage and Marcus releasing his big guns with the sleeveless vest (where did those come from), this was a disappoint to me. I thought it would be amazing, but his vocals weren't there for me.

 

On a sidenote: every time they show Michael's kids they seemed bored out of their mind...could make an attempt to try and look intrigued to be there kiddos!

 

Time for Chris Rene and now I feel he might be able to break out into a great performance, which would be a change for him, in my eyes. So, I lied...he did an okay performance, which is normal for him. I am not impressed with this guy and don't know how he has made it this far in the competition...I think we say goodbye to him this week.

 

So, having high expectations all show and being letdown each and every performance, I am hoping they saved the best for last with Melanie Amaro. She better wow me, or the Michael Jackson episode is a complete bust. Two things first: she looked absolutely beautiful tonight and this girl has amazing vocals. Now with that being said, she needs to change it up one week and do something different...something with more pop.
